15-04-2024, 04:23
Als ich anfing, mit VirtualBox zu arbeiten, war ich begeistert, meine eigene kleine Oase virtueller Maschinen zum Testen, Entwickeln und manchmal einfach nur zum Herumspielen zu schaffen. Doch wie viele von uns stieß ich bald auf das Problem langsamer Leistung. Kennst du dieses Gefühl, wenn du auf einen Ladebildschirm starrst und dich fragst, wo all die Leistung hinsteckt? Ja, ich war auch schon dort. Lass uns also darüber sprechen, wie du langsame Leistung in deinen VirtualBox-VMs beheben kannst.
Zunächst einmal ist eines der Hauptprobleme hinter langsamer Leistung in VirtualBox-VMs in der Regel die Ressourcenzuweisung. Als ich anfing, wurde mir nicht ganz bewusst, wie viel CPU und RAM ich für meine VMs zuweisen musste. Es geht um das Gleichgewicht. Wenn du einen Computer mit 8 GB RAM hast und ein paar VMs betreibst, musst du sicherstellen, dass du den RAM weise zuweist. Ich empfehle dir, genügend für das Hostsystem zu lassen, damit es auch reibungslos läuft. Eine gute Faustregel, die ich gefunden habe, ist, etwa die Hälfte deines RAMs jeder VM zuzuweisen, aber behalte auch im Auge, wie dein Host läuft. Die Überwachung der Ressourcennutzung auf beiden Seiten hilft oft erheblich.
Jetzt lass uns über virtuelle Prozessoren sprechen. Du könntest begeistert sein, so viele CPUs wie möglich in deine VM zu werfen, aber das kann eigentlich die Leistung verringern. Ich dachte einmal, dass mehr Kerne mehr Geschwindigkeit bedeuten, aber es kann zu Leistungsengpässen führen, wenn dein Hostcomputer selbst die Last nicht bewältigen kann. Wenn du dir über die richtige Anzahl an virtuellen Prozessoren unsicher bist, fange mit ein oder zwei an und passe sie dann basierend auf der Leistung an.
Ein weiterer Bereich, den du überprüfen solltest, sind die Speichereinstellungen. Ich kann nicht genug betonen, wie wichtig es ist, eine Solid-State-Disk anstelle einer älteren HDD zu verwenden. Als ich schließlich mein Setup aufrüstete und alles auf SSDs umstellte, verbesserte sich die Leistung dramatisch. Wenn du keinen Zugriff auf eine SSD hast, stelle sicher, dass deine virtuellen Festplatten nicht dynamisch zugewiesen sind, da sie die Leistung verringern können, wenn sie ständig neu dimensioniert werden. Stattdessen solltest du eine feste Größe wählen, wenn du weißt, wie viel Platz du benötigst. Das wird die Lese-/Schreibgeschwindigkeiten erheblich verbessern.
Die Netzwerkverbindung kann ebenfalls ein Game-Changer sein. Du kannst deine VMs so konfigurieren, dass sie NAT- oder Bridged-Netzwerk verwenden. Ich sehe oft eine Verlangsamung bei der Verwendung von NAT, insbesondere wenn ich große Datenübertragungen durchführe. Wenn du auf Bridged-Netzwerk umschalten kannst, ermöglicht das deiner VM, wie ein separates Gerät in deinem Netzwerk zu agieren, was in der Regel zu verbesserten Geschwindigkeiten führt. Denke jedoch daran, dass dies nicht immer eine Option ist, wenn du dich in einer eingeschränkten Netzwerkumgebung befindest.
Manchmal übersiehst du möglicherweise die Betriebssystemeinstellungen innerhalb deiner VM. Stelle sicher, dass du das Gastbetriebssystem für Geschwindigkeit optimiert hast. Installiere die neuesten Updates und, wenn möglich, die VirtualBox Guest Additions. Diese Ergänzungen sind großartig, da sie optimierte Treiber und Tools bereitstellen, die die Leistung erheblich verbessern können. Ich vergesse oft, sie zu installieren, aber sobald ich es tue, funktionieren meine VMs normalerweise viel reibungsloser.
Außerdem, wenn die Hauptaufgabe deiner VM ressourcenintensiv ist, wie z.B. das Ausführen einer Datenbank oder einer großen Anwendung, stelle sicher, dass du alle unnötigen Dienste oder Autostart-Elemente im Gastbetriebssystem deaktivierst. Manchmal sind es die kleinen Dinge – wie eine Menge Programme, die versuchen, im Hintergrund zu laufen –, die dein Erlebnis wirklich verlangsamen.
Ein weiterer Trick, auf den ich gestoßen bin, ist das Anpassen der Video-Speichereinstellungen. Es ist ziemlich einfach, dies zu ignorieren, aber wenn du eine VM betreibst, die grafische Arbeiten oder sogar nur eine einfache GUI-Desktop-Oberfläche macht, kann es hilfreich sein, die der VM zugewiesene Videospeichergröße zu erhöhen. Ich empfehle immer, sie auf die maximal erlaubte Menge festzulegen, da du nie weißt, wann etwas zusätzliche grafische Leistung erforderlich sein könnte.
Wenn du bemerkst, dass deine Leistung zu bestimmten Zeiten oder Arbeitslastniveaus sinkt, können Überwachungstools Lebensretter sein. Nutze Tools, um im Auge zu behalten, wie Ressourcen genutzt werden. Sowohl Host als auch Gast müssen sorgfältig beobachtet werden. Du könntest feststellen, dass dein Hostsystem seine Grenzen erreicht, was zu Verlangsamungen in deinen VMs führen kann. Ich benutze gerne Tools wie den Task-Manager oder den Ressourcenmonitor in Windows, und es gibt auch großartige Linux-Tools, aber was wirklich zählt, ist, dass du die Nutzungsmuster insgesamt im Auge behältst.
Die Verwendung von Snapshots ist ein weiterer Teil der effektiven Nutzung von VirtualBox. Während sie fantastisch sind, um deine VM in einem bestimmten Zustand zu halten, kann die Verwendung zu vieler Snapshots die Leistung bremsen. Ich habe diesen Fehler zu Beginn gemacht. Es schien so praktisch zu sein, alles an seinem Ort einzufrieren, aber nach einer Weile fühlte sich die VM an, als würde sie durch den Schlamm waten. Wenn du dich mit einer Menge Snapshots wiederfindest, ziehe in Betracht, die alten zu löschen, die du nicht mehr benötigst.
Lass uns auch die Netzwerkkonfiguration innerhalb von VirtualBox selbst ansprechen. Manchmal kann das Anpassen dieser Einstellungen zu Leistungsverbesserungen führen. Ändere den Typ des Netzwerkadapters; ich stelle oft fest, dass der Einsatz eines „Bridged Adapter“ besser funktioniert als „NAT“. Du solltest verschiedene Adapter – Intel, AMD usw. – ausprobieren, um zu sehen, welcher am besten für deine Anwendung funktioniert.
Es ist wichtig sicherzustellen, dass die Virtualisierungstechnologie aktiviert ist. Manchmal kann sie in deinen BIOS-Einstellungen deaktiviert sein. Wenn du einen neueren CPU hast, gibt es eine gute Chance, dass er diese Art von Unterstützung bietet, und das Aktivieren kann zu einem spürbaren Geschwindigkeitsschub für deine VMs führen. Also überspringe nicht diesen Schritt; du würdest überrascht sein, wie viel Unterschied das machen kann.
Abschließend kann ich nicht genug betonen, wie wichtig es ist, deine Version von VirtualBox aktuell zu halten. Das Entwicklungsteam arbeitet kontinuierlich an Leistungsverbesserungen, und die Verwendung der neuesten Version kann dir Zugang zu diesem Optimierungsschatz geben. Ich habe mich schon einmal mit veralteten Versionen erwischt und dachte: „Was könnte schiefgehen?“ Nun, lass mich dir sagen, als ich schließlich aktualisierte, fühlte es sich an, als hätten meine VMs einen ganz neuen Lebenshauch bekommen.
Nachdem du all diese Tricks ausprobiert hast und hoffentlich deine VMs reibungsloser laufen, denke daran, wie wichtig es ist, alles zu sichern. Hier kann BackupChain wirklich glänzen, insbesondere für VirtualBox-Nutzer. Es bietet eine robuste Lösung, die auf die effiziente Sicherung von VMs zugeschnitten ist. Du kannst Sicherungen mühelos planen und sicherstellen, dass du wertvolle Entwicklungsarbeiten oder Konfigurationen niemals verlierst. Und da es mit inkrementellen Backups funktioniert, sparst du Speicherplatz, während du deine Daten sicher hältst. Es ist eine Win-Win-Situation!
Du siehst also, dass die Behebung langsamer Leistung in VirtualBox nicht nur darin besteht, ein paar Einstellungen anzupassen; es ist eine Kombination mehrerer Faktoren, die harmonisch zusammenarbeiten. Mit dem richtigen Ansatz und etwas Geduld kannst du dein Erlebnis mit virtuellen Maschinen erheblich verbessern.
Zunächst einmal ist eines der Hauptprobleme hinter langsamer Leistung in VirtualBox-VMs in der Regel die Ressourcenzuweisung. Als ich anfing, wurde mir nicht ganz bewusst, wie viel CPU und RAM ich für meine VMs zuweisen musste. Es geht um das Gleichgewicht. Wenn du einen Computer mit 8 GB RAM hast und ein paar VMs betreibst, musst du sicherstellen, dass du den RAM weise zuweist. Ich empfehle dir, genügend für das Hostsystem zu lassen, damit es auch reibungslos läuft. Eine gute Faustregel, die ich gefunden habe, ist, etwa die Hälfte deines RAMs jeder VM zuzuweisen, aber behalte auch im Auge, wie dein Host läuft. Die Überwachung der Ressourcennutzung auf beiden Seiten hilft oft erheblich.
Jetzt lass uns über virtuelle Prozessoren sprechen. Du könntest begeistert sein, so viele CPUs wie möglich in deine VM zu werfen, aber das kann eigentlich die Leistung verringern. Ich dachte einmal, dass mehr Kerne mehr Geschwindigkeit bedeuten, aber es kann zu Leistungsengpässen führen, wenn dein Hostcomputer selbst die Last nicht bewältigen kann. Wenn du dir über die richtige Anzahl an virtuellen Prozessoren unsicher bist, fange mit ein oder zwei an und passe sie dann basierend auf der Leistung an.
Ein weiterer Bereich, den du überprüfen solltest, sind die Speichereinstellungen. Ich kann nicht genug betonen, wie wichtig es ist, eine Solid-State-Disk anstelle einer älteren HDD zu verwenden. Als ich schließlich mein Setup aufrüstete und alles auf SSDs umstellte, verbesserte sich die Leistung dramatisch. Wenn du keinen Zugriff auf eine SSD hast, stelle sicher, dass deine virtuellen Festplatten nicht dynamisch zugewiesen sind, da sie die Leistung verringern können, wenn sie ständig neu dimensioniert werden. Stattdessen solltest du eine feste Größe wählen, wenn du weißt, wie viel Platz du benötigst. Das wird die Lese-/Schreibgeschwindigkeiten erheblich verbessern.
Die Netzwerkverbindung kann ebenfalls ein Game-Changer sein. Du kannst deine VMs so konfigurieren, dass sie NAT- oder Bridged-Netzwerk verwenden. Ich sehe oft eine Verlangsamung bei der Verwendung von NAT, insbesondere wenn ich große Datenübertragungen durchführe. Wenn du auf Bridged-Netzwerk umschalten kannst, ermöglicht das deiner VM, wie ein separates Gerät in deinem Netzwerk zu agieren, was in der Regel zu verbesserten Geschwindigkeiten führt. Denke jedoch daran, dass dies nicht immer eine Option ist, wenn du dich in einer eingeschränkten Netzwerkumgebung befindest.
Manchmal übersiehst du möglicherweise die Betriebssystemeinstellungen innerhalb deiner VM. Stelle sicher, dass du das Gastbetriebssystem für Geschwindigkeit optimiert hast. Installiere die neuesten Updates und, wenn möglich, die VirtualBox Guest Additions. Diese Ergänzungen sind großartig, da sie optimierte Treiber und Tools bereitstellen, die die Leistung erheblich verbessern können. Ich vergesse oft, sie zu installieren, aber sobald ich es tue, funktionieren meine VMs normalerweise viel reibungsloser.
Außerdem, wenn die Hauptaufgabe deiner VM ressourcenintensiv ist, wie z.B. das Ausführen einer Datenbank oder einer großen Anwendung, stelle sicher, dass du alle unnötigen Dienste oder Autostart-Elemente im Gastbetriebssystem deaktivierst. Manchmal sind es die kleinen Dinge – wie eine Menge Programme, die versuchen, im Hintergrund zu laufen –, die dein Erlebnis wirklich verlangsamen.
Ein weiterer Trick, auf den ich gestoßen bin, ist das Anpassen der Video-Speichereinstellungen. Es ist ziemlich einfach, dies zu ignorieren, aber wenn du eine VM betreibst, die grafische Arbeiten oder sogar nur eine einfache GUI-Desktop-Oberfläche macht, kann es hilfreich sein, die der VM zugewiesene Videospeichergröße zu erhöhen. Ich empfehle immer, sie auf die maximal erlaubte Menge festzulegen, da du nie weißt, wann etwas zusätzliche grafische Leistung erforderlich sein könnte.
Wenn du bemerkst, dass deine Leistung zu bestimmten Zeiten oder Arbeitslastniveaus sinkt, können Überwachungstools Lebensretter sein. Nutze Tools, um im Auge zu behalten, wie Ressourcen genutzt werden. Sowohl Host als auch Gast müssen sorgfältig beobachtet werden. Du könntest feststellen, dass dein Hostsystem seine Grenzen erreicht, was zu Verlangsamungen in deinen VMs führen kann. Ich benutze gerne Tools wie den Task-Manager oder den Ressourcenmonitor in Windows, und es gibt auch großartige Linux-Tools, aber was wirklich zählt, ist, dass du die Nutzungsmuster insgesamt im Auge behältst.
Die Verwendung von Snapshots ist ein weiterer Teil der effektiven Nutzung von VirtualBox. Während sie fantastisch sind, um deine VM in einem bestimmten Zustand zu halten, kann die Verwendung zu vieler Snapshots die Leistung bremsen. Ich habe diesen Fehler zu Beginn gemacht. Es schien so praktisch zu sein, alles an seinem Ort einzufrieren, aber nach einer Weile fühlte sich die VM an, als würde sie durch den Schlamm waten. Wenn du dich mit einer Menge Snapshots wiederfindest, ziehe in Betracht, die alten zu löschen, die du nicht mehr benötigst.
Lass uns auch die Netzwerkkonfiguration innerhalb von VirtualBox selbst ansprechen. Manchmal kann das Anpassen dieser Einstellungen zu Leistungsverbesserungen führen. Ändere den Typ des Netzwerkadapters; ich stelle oft fest, dass der Einsatz eines „Bridged Adapter“ besser funktioniert als „NAT“. Du solltest verschiedene Adapter – Intel, AMD usw. – ausprobieren, um zu sehen, welcher am besten für deine Anwendung funktioniert.
Es ist wichtig sicherzustellen, dass die Virtualisierungstechnologie aktiviert ist. Manchmal kann sie in deinen BIOS-Einstellungen deaktiviert sein. Wenn du einen neueren CPU hast, gibt es eine gute Chance, dass er diese Art von Unterstützung bietet, und das Aktivieren kann zu einem spürbaren Geschwindigkeitsschub für deine VMs führen. Also überspringe nicht diesen Schritt; du würdest überrascht sein, wie viel Unterschied das machen kann.
Abschließend kann ich nicht genug betonen, wie wichtig es ist, deine Version von VirtualBox aktuell zu halten. Das Entwicklungsteam arbeitet kontinuierlich an Leistungsverbesserungen, und die Verwendung der neuesten Version kann dir Zugang zu diesem Optimierungsschatz geben. Ich habe mich schon einmal mit veralteten Versionen erwischt und dachte: „Was könnte schiefgehen?“ Nun, lass mich dir sagen, als ich schließlich aktualisierte, fühlte es sich an, als hätten meine VMs einen ganz neuen Lebenshauch bekommen.
Nachdem du all diese Tricks ausprobiert hast und hoffentlich deine VMs reibungsloser laufen, denke daran, wie wichtig es ist, alles zu sichern. Hier kann BackupChain wirklich glänzen, insbesondere für VirtualBox-Nutzer. Es bietet eine robuste Lösung, die auf die effiziente Sicherung von VMs zugeschnitten ist. Du kannst Sicherungen mühelos planen und sicherstellen, dass du wertvolle Entwicklungsarbeiten oder Konfigurationen niemals verlierst. Und da es mit inkrementellen Backups funktioniert, sparst du Speicherplatz, während du deine Daten sicher hältst. Es ist eine Win-Win-Situation!
Du siehst also, dass die Behebung langsamer Leistung in VirtualBox nicht nur darin besteht, ein paar Einstellungen anzupassen; es ist eine Kombination mehrerer Faktoren, die harmonisch zusammenarbeiten. Mit dem richtigen Ansatz und etwas Geduld kannst du dein Erlebnis mit virtuellen Maschinen erheblich verbessern.